Taking action for nature

The 17th meeting of the Conference of the Parties (COP17) to the Convention on Biological Diversity (CBD) will take place from 19 to 30 October 2026 in Yerevan, Armenia. During the conference, Parties will undertake the first global review of collective progress in implementing the Kunming–Montreal Global Biodiversity Framework (KMGBF).

The Netherlands Pavilion

Building on the success of COP16, we are pleased to welcome you back to the Netherlands Pavilion – a platform for knowledge exchange, co-creation, and collaboration between governments, businesses, knowledge institutions, NGOs, and international stakeholders. The programme of the Netherlands Pavilion will be coordinated by the Ministry of Agriculture, Fisheries, Food Security and Nature, the Ministry of Infrastructure and Water Management,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Partners for Water. 

Proposals to host a session at the NL Pavilion can be submitted until August 14th. 

Proposed sessions should address one or more of the following focus themes:

  • Mobilising finance for biodiversity
  • Monitoring, review, and follow-up actions on the global review
  • The nexus of biodiversity, climate, food systems, and/or water
  • Mainstreaming biodiversity
  • Nature-based Solutions
